Software Engineer

Lloyds Technology Centre


Date: 5 days ago
City: Hyderabad
Contract type: Full time
End Date We Support Flexible Working – Click here for more information on flexible working options Flexible Working Options Hybrid Working Job Description Summary Aims to deliver the highest quality customer driven software whilst continually challenging, motivating, mentoring and supporting their engineering teams. They will work in cross-disciplinary teams delivering exciting customer driven solutions and high quality software and showcase excellent interpersonal and communication skill whilst efficiently working across the project life cycle to ensure software operates as intended. This is a leadership level role and will blend both deep domain and technical expertise within a feature team and great passion for coaching and developing people in a “player-coach” model Job Description About the role We’re seeking a talented Senior Java Engineer to join our team; you’ll be responsible for designing and developing high throughput applications using java with high quality production ready code to deliver functionality to our customers. You’ll be accountable for ensuring all decisions are made within a sound risk framework and within Group standards and appetite while managing the full software development process within an agile environment What you’ll do
  • Design and develop applications in Java with automated tests to ensure it meets business functionality.
  • Implement monitoring for applications and analyse health & performance to improve.
  • Be part of cross-functional product engineering team and adhere engineering standards throughout the software development life cycle.
  • Pair with other engineers to review the code considering the quality standards agreed to follow in the team.
  • Making sure code is kept up to date and version controlled within a repository.
  • Collaborate with architects and other senior engineers to produce application/design documentation.
  • Problem solving/debugging application production issues and minimise customer impact.
  • Mentor/coach the engineers to deliver high quality applications that are designed for security, testing, maintainability and observability
What you’ll need
  • Hands on experience in building enterprise REST API (with open API standards) in Java (min Java 11) and experience with Java frameworks like Hibernate, spring boot, spring core and spring security.
  • Hands-on experience working with Kafka, including experience with Kafka Streams, Kafka Connect, and Kafka API.
  • Hands-on experience with SQL and experience working with GCP Cloud SQL and Spanner
  • Experience with TDD practices like automated unit and integration tests and Dev Ops practices like CI/CD
  • Experience in designing and building high volume distributed event driven systems at scale, fault tolerant, resilience and highly observable
  • Experience working with messaging systems such as GCP Pub/Sub.
  • Good knowledge using modern technologies e.g. Docker, Kubernetes, Github actions, Istio Service mesh, Helm, api-gateway, SRE, DORA concepts and metrics and Scalable / NoSQL Databases etc.
  • Experience with Public Cloud Solution, ideally GCP
Nice-to-Have Skills: Strong understanding of DevOps principles

How to apply

To apply for this job you need to authorize on our website. If you don't have an account yet, please register.

Post a resume

Similar jobs

Business Analyst Lead

Broadridge, Hyderabad
6 days ago
At Broadridge, we've built a culture where the highest goal is to empower others to accomplish more. If you’re passionate about developing your career, while helping others along the way, come join the Broadridge team. Identifies business needs and determines solutions to business problems. Solutions may consist of a software-systems development component, process improvement, organizational change or strategic planning and...

Technical Lead

Infinite Computer Solutions Ltd., Hyderabad
6 days ago
AZURE DATABRICS, PYSPAR, AZURE DATA FACTORY Technical skills Azure ADF, ADB -Pyspark , SSIS( Azure ADF and ADB-Pyspark are must skills)Candidate should have strong hands on skills in Azure ADF, ADB and SSIS. Preferably with Healthcare domain concepts. Should have strong understanding on Datawarehousing and ETL concepts. Primary Skillset- Azure Data factory, Azure Databricks, SQL, Pyspark, Python, Azure Synapse, Hadoop,...

Quality Assurance Specialist – Service Desk Operations

UST Global, Hyderabad
1 week ago
3 - 5 Years 1 Opening Hyderabad Role description Mandatory Skills: Quality Assurance Data Analysis Agile Methodologies Six Sigma Reporting Collaboration Key Responsibilities: Quality Assurance: Monitor and evaluate service desk interactions to ensure compliance with company standards and high customer satisfaction. Data Analysis: Collect, analyze, and interpret performance data to identify trends, patterns, and areas for improvement. Agile Methodologies: Apply...